Reviewed by James Yelland

This eponymous collection from ex-pro baseballer Brady Toops is a debut release but you could never tell with a distinctive sound and technique, delivered with real confidence. Fusing elements of folk, rock 'n' roll, spirituals and gospel music, Brady's 11 tracks here are intended to "close the gap between the spiritual and secular". Largely, he is successful in his aim. With a vintage yet contemporary sound, this album feels awash with the sound of his Nashville base. With his rich, granite-chiselled voice and clearly strongly influenced by the legendary Johnny Cash, these tracks make for a deep, rewarding and satisfying listen. Produced expertly by David Leonard (of All Sons & Daughters), there are at least eight or nine excellent tracks here, reminiscent of another top quality release from this year, Samuel Lane's 'The Fire'. Particular highlights have to be the contemporised versions of the spiritual classics, "Swing Low Sweet Chariot" and "Soon And Very Soon". A fine album.
